Legal Validity and Authenticity of Digital Signatures
Digital signatures are pivotal in establishing the legal validity and authenticity of online contracts. They utilize cryptographic techniques to confirm the signer’s identity and ensure the document’s integrity. This enhances trust and enforceability in digital environments.
Legal frameworks such as the ESIGN Act (U.S.) and the eIDAS regulation (EU) recognize digital signatures as legally equivalent to handwritten signatures when properly implemented. These laws set standards for secure digital signing processes, reinforcing their legitimacy in contractual disputes.
However, the authenticity of digital signatures depends on robust certification authorities and secure public key infrastructures. If these elements are compromised or improperly managed, the validity of the digital signature may be challenged in courts. Therefore, compliance with security standards is essential.

Cross-Border Digital Contract Enforcement Complications
Cross-border digital contract enforcement presents several complex challenges due to differing legal systems and jurisdictional boundaries. Variations in national laws often lead to inconsistencies in recognizing and enforcing online contracts, complicating dispute resolution processes.
Legal recognition of digital signatures and electronic records varies across jurisdictions, resulting in uncertainties about enforceability in foreign courts. These discrepancies can hinder contractual clarity and create legal gaps that parties must navigate carefully.
Furthermore, jurisdictional conflicts arise when multiple countries claim authority over a dispute. Identifying the applicable law becomes difficult, especially if parties are in different legal environments with contrasting regulatory standards. This often prolongs enforcement procedures and increases legal costs.
The absence of a unified international framework for digital contract enforcement exacerbates these problems. While some treaties and multilateral agreements address cross-border electronic transactions, their scope is limited, leaving many challenges unresolved for online contracts operating across diverse legal jurisdictions.

Regulatory Frameworks Governing Digital Contract Enforcement
Regulatory frameworks governing digital contract enforcement are vital in establishing legal standards for online agreements. These frameworks aim to ensure the validity, authenticity, and enforceability of digital contracts across different jurisdictions. They provide clarity on issues such as digital signatures, data protection, and dispute resolution.
International treaties, such as the UNCITRAL Model Law on Electronic Commerce, serve as guiding principles for harmonizing laws and facilitating cross-border enforcement of digital contracts. Many countries have adopted national legislation that aligns with these standards, promoting legal certainty and predictability.
However, discrepancies between regional regulations can complicate enforcement, especially in cross-border transactions. Legal recognition of electronic signatures and smart contracts varies, influencing their enforceability. Continual updates to regulatory frameworks are necessary to keep pace with technological advancements and emerging enforcement challenges.

Legal Recognition and Limitations
Legal recognition of digital contracts varies across jurisdictions and is often limited by specific statutory and procedural requirements. While many regions accept electronic signatures and digital contracts as binding, certain legal standards must be met for enforcement.
In most legal systems, digital signatures are only considered valid if they meet criteria of authenticity, integrity, and non-repudiation. Elements such as digital certificates and reputable signing platforms enhance recognition but do not eliminate all doubts surrounding enforceability.
Limitations also stem from inconsistent legal frameworks, where some laws are still evolving to fully accommodate digital or blockchain-based contracts. This creates uncertainties, especially in cross-border disputes, where differing national standards may affect enforceability.
Moreover, challenges persist with verifying the identity of contract parties online, risking invalidations if proper authentication measures are absent. These legal recognition issues underscore the importance of complying with jurisdiction-specific regulations to ensure digital contract enforceability.
